>>the certificates are carried ... in soBGP in a new BGP message.
> 
> 
> btw, am i supposed to be cheered by yet another overloading of
> bgp?
Well gee Randy, I think you would have been happy.  Here we are carrying
related data in the same place.  And, in the long run, the
authentication information will become just as integral a piece of BGP
as the NLRI are.
Even you don't get to complain about data duplication and protocol
"overloading" in the same day.  Make up your mind.  All protocols MUST
have some redundancy.  You want it in one place?  Or more than one?
